1 copy of Shāhnāmah by Firdawsī
Title: ShāhnāmahTitle: شاهنامهTitle: FragmentPart of a leaf from an Injū MS. of the epic poem Shāhnāmah ( شاهنامه ) , begun by Daqīqī, Muḥammad ibn Aḥmad, d. 980 or 81, دقیقی، محمد بن احمد , but mostly the work of Firdawsī, d. 415/1025, فردوسی
Illustrated
Title has been supplied by Waley 1998, page 47.
Language(s): PersianReferences
For a more detailed description see Waley 1998, page 47.Physical Description
Form: codexExtent: 1 fDimensions (leaf): 12Decoration
Illustrated
History
Origin: Southern Iran; 8th century AHRecord Sources
